Standard: Contact Between the Social Worker/Clinician, the Child, the Family and Resource Parent(s) or Other Alternate Care Providers

February 25, 2008 Contact between children and guardians should be used to continually assess the child's safety and to review the family's progress towards achieving the desired results of case plans. Regular contact between the social worker/clinician and the child's parents can serve as motivation for parents to make progress on their case goals and provides a means of supporting their efforts.
